WK13 DWW is a 2013 Morgan Plus 4 in Grey with a 1,999c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.3%.
Across all 2013 Morgan Plus 4 models, the average MOT pass rate is 87.5% with a typical mileage of 10,670 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Morgan Plus 4 fails its MOT is brake binding, accounting for 137 recorded failures. If you're considering buying WK13 DWW,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Morgan Plus 4 typically stays on UK roads for around 72 years. At 13 years old, this Morgan Plus 4 is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
